Macro Regime Monitor

The broader macro environment plays a critical role in shaping market direction. Here's a snapshot of key indicators and their respective thresholds:

Metric Current Key Level
S&P 500 6606.49 (-0.27%) 6500 (Support) / 6700 (Resistance)
VIX 24.85 20 (Risk-On) / 30 (Risk-Off)
10Y Treasury Yield 4.31% 4.00% (Dovish Shift) / 4.50% (Hawkish Pressure)
WTI Crude Oil $94.86 $90 (Support) / $100 (Resistance)
US Dollar Index (DXY) 99.41 98 (Weakness) / 100 (Strength)
